阅读量:2
CentOS配置Java的主要方法
一、通过YUM包管理器安装(推荐新手使用)
YUM是CentOS默认的包管理工具,可自动解决依赖关系,操作简便。适用于安装OpenJDK(开源版本,无需付费)。
- 更新系统包:运行
sudo yum update -y,确保系统软件包为最新版本。 - 安装OpenJDK:执行
sudo yum install -y java-(如-openjdk-devel java-1.8.0-openjdk-devel安装Java 8,java-17-openjdk-devel安装Java 17)。安装完成后,java -version和javac -version命令可验证运行时环境和编译器是否安装成功。 - 设置默认Java版本(可选):若系统有多个Java版本,运行
sudo alternatives --config java,根据提示选择所需版本。
二、手动安装Oracle JDK(选择特定版本)
若需要使用Oracle官方提供的JDK(如最新商业版本),可通过下载tar.gz压缩包手动安装。
- 下载安装包:从Oracle官网下载对应版本的JDK tar.gz文件(如
jdk-17_linux-x64_bin.tar.gz),确保选择Linux x64架构。 - 解压并移动到指定目录:创建Java安装目录(如
/usr/local/java),运行tar -zxvf jdk-解压文件,再通过-linux-x64.tar.gz -C /usr/local/java mv命令重命名目录(如jdk1.17.0_01)。 - 配置环境变量:编辑全局配置文件
/etc/profile,添加以下内容(替换为实际路径):运行export JAVA_HOME=/usr/local/java/jdk-export PATH=$JAVA_HOME/bin:$PATH export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ar source /etc/profile使配置生效。
三、手动安装OpenJDK RPM包(适用于特定场景)
若YUM仓库中没有所需OpenJDK版本,可下载Oracle提供的RPM包手动安装。
- 下载RPM包:从Oracle官网下载OpenJDK的RPM文件(如
jdk-17_linux-x64_bin.rpm)。 - 安装RPM包:运行
sudo rpm -ivh jdk-,系统会自动安装JDK到-linux-x64.rpm /usr/java/jdk-目录。 - 后续步骤:后续环境变量配置与手动安装Oracle JDK一致(参考方法二第3步)。
四、配置环境变量(关键步骤)
无论采用哪种安装方式,均需配置环境变量以确保Java命令全局可用。
- 查找JAVA_HOME路径:若通过YUM安装,路径通常为
/usr/lib/jvm/java-;若手动安装,路径为解压后的JDK目录(如-openjdk- /usr/local/java/jdk-)。 - 永久生效配置:除修改
/etc/profile(全局有效)外,还可编辑用户目录下的.bashrc文件(仅当前用户有效),添加相同的环境变量内容,运行source ~/.bashrc使配置生效。 - 验证配置:运行
echo $JAVA_HOME应输出JDK安装路径;java -version和javac -version应显示对应Java版本的详细信息。
以上就是关于“centos配置java有哪些方法”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m